Arvutiteaduse instituut
  1. Kursused
  2. 2022/23 kevad
  3. Andmebaasid (LTAT.03.004)
EN
Logi sisse

Andmebaasid 2022/23 kevad

  • Kursuse korraldus
  • Loengud
  • Praktikumid
  • Kodulugemised (autorid: Margus Roo ja Piret Luik)
  • Rühmatöö

Praktikumid

Praktikumid algavad 25. õppenädalast. Praktikumideks on vajalik loenguvideote ja lugemismaterjalide läbitöötamine. NB! 36. õppenädalal esmaspäevastes praktikumirühmades osalejatel on võimalus liituda mõne teisipäevase rühmaga või sooritada praktikumi juhendite alusel iseseisvalt! Iseseisvalt praktikumi sooritamise võimalus on sel nädalal kõikidel rühmadel.

Koduülesanded ja praktikumide ülesanded on vaja esitada Moodle keskkonda.

õnPraktikum E või TEnne järgmise nädala praktikumi
24Praktikumi ei toimu.Paigaldada praktikumides vajaminev tarkvara ja importida andmebaas. Lugeda: Päringulause (algus).
25Sissejuhatus praktikumidesse. Kõige lihtsamad päringud.Lugeda: Andmetüübid ja Päringulause (jätk). Sooritada koduülesanne 1 (2p).
26Mitmest tabelist päringud.Alustada rühmatööd. Esitada rühmatöö faili link Moodle foorumisse. Lugeda: Alampäringud, operaatorid UNION ja JOIN. Sooritada koduülesanne 2 (2p).
27Tabelite ja kirjete muutmine.Esitada lõpetatud tunnitöö (1p). Kommenteerida vähemalt kolme Moodle keskkonda esitatud teise rühma mudelit (2p). Individuaalne töö!
28Kontrolltöö 1 loengute materjali peale. Tabelite loomine. Massandmete ja päringuga andmete sisestamine. Välisvõti.Lugeda: Tabelite loomine ja välisvõti. Sooritada koduülesanne 3 ja esitada sellega koos tunnitöö (2+1p).
29Relatsioonalgebra.Rühmatöö jätk: Parandada oma mudelit saadud kommentaaride põhjal ning teisendada see relatsiooniliseks mudeliks.
30Oma mudeli seminar.Lugeda: Vaadete loomine ning vaadete muutmine ja vaate kaudu andmete sisestamine. Sooritada koduülesanne 4 (2p).
31Vaated ja päringud.Tunnitöö lõpetada ja esitada (1p).
32Normaalkujud.Lugeda: Funktsioonide ja Protseduuride loomine. Sooritada koduülesanne 5 (2p).
33Kontrolltöö 2 loengute materjali peale. Andmebaasi loomine.Lõpetada tunnitöö (2p). Rühmatöö jätk: Oma mudeli normaalkuju kontrollimine ja vajadusel normaalkujule viimine. Sellele vastava andmebaasi loomine.
34Funktsioonid ja protseduurid.Lugeda:indeksite loomine ja trigerite loomine. Sooritada koduülesanne 6 ja sellega koos esitada lõpetatud tunnitöö (2+1p).
35Kontrolltöö 3 loengute materjali peale. Trigerid ja indeksid. Päringu optimeerija.Lõpetada rühmatöö (luua funktsioonid ja protseduurid) ja esitada see ülesande vahendiga. Esitada lõpetatud tunnitöö.
36Andmete varundamine, taastamine. Kasutajagruppidele õiguste andmine. Dokumentatsiooni loomine.Esitada lõpetatud tunnitöö (1p). Kordamine eksami I osaks.
37Arvestuspäringud. NB! Kõigil auditooriumis! Neil, kel on kontrolltööde lävendid täitmata, kontrolltööde järeltööd 
38Arvestuspäringute sooritamise kordusvõimalus, kui 37 õppenädalal ebaõnnestus. NB! Kõigil auditooriumis! Neil, kel on kontrolltööde lävendid täitmata, kontrolltööde järeltööd 
  • Arvutiteaduse instituut
  • Loodus- ja täppisteaduste valdkond
  • Tartu Ülikool
Tehniliste probleemide või küsimuste korral kirjuta:

Kursuse sisu ja korralduslike küsimustega pöörduge kursuse korraldajate poole.
Õppematerjalide varalised autoriõigused kuuluvad Tartu Ülikoolile. Õppematerjalide kasutamine on lubatud autoriõiguse seaduses ettenähtud teose vaba kasutamise eesmärkidel ja tingimustel. Õppematerjalide kasutamisel on kasutaja kohustatud viitama õppematerjalide autorile.
Õppematerjalide kasutamine muudel eesmärkidel on lubatud ainult Tartu Ülikooli eelneval kirjalikul nõusolekul.
Courses’i keskkonna kasutustingimused